如果有一天,我的學生被我發現交出來的功課原來搵人做,但向我解釋裏面的概念是他「原創」的,只不過做功課的人不是他本人、是他請人替他做而已,那聽起來有沒有不妥? 又或我們學者要出研究論文,我只提供「原創」的研究概念,然後搵人從頭到尾幫我寫,但刊登論文的時候就出我自己的名字,亦無提及整個研究的執行,其實是出自他人之手,被人踢爆後,我一味强調idea是原創的,還大言不慚地說:「概念是我的,只是文字別人代筆罷了!」那有沒有問題?日後的學術誠信還能否站得住腳? 有些事,是基於很根本的道德常理認知,例如學生交功課當然是假設出自其人手筆,學者出論文當然是假設不會抄襲、不會假手於人,若這麼根本的認知也欠缺的話,是有問題的,即使一味強調擁有「原創」概念。 有一句說話,道出重點來:「Ideas are cheap, execution is everything」。 誰沒有idea?誰不曉得原創?有能力者,是能把腦袋裏面的概念執行出來。學術界的基本倫理是:不僅概念要原創,執行也必須透明誠實。若按此邏輯,所有學生都可以僱人寫論文,然後理直氣壯地說:「想法是我的。」–那學術還有何誠信可言? 有dignity(尊嚴)和Integrity(誠信)才能有資格獲得尊重,這不僅是求學問的態度,也是做人處事的基本原則,開學伊始,與學子共勉。 撰文 : 利嘉敏 欄名 : 攻關女子 Source link
